Output e229f6da0ef154e2c38107f9411913a63451293cc656e0feb236c37965d7b6c3:3

value
1842195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a397655e3b06c433960aa949aa7a37b50d01ed8 OP_EQUAL
address
3HD5dhfVhGy2BC9y23sHcpiDKHeye9MWTx
transaction
e229f6da0ef154e2c38107f9411913a63451293cc656e0feb236c37965d7b6c3
spent
true